Recent NBA history has made one thing very clear to any Boston Celtics fan or general basketball fan that has followed this wonderful sport: you will not win a championship if you cannot shoot the basketball. Dating back to the 2011-12 season (the first true season of small-ball as a result of Erik Spoelstra’s Miami Heat), there has not been an NBA champion that lacked 3-point shooting.
The San Antonio Spurs and Toronto Raptors featured two long-range marksmen in Kawhi Leonard (career 38%) and Danny Green (40%) that always seemed to hit the big-3 at the most opportune times.
